Your Responsibilities
Due to our success and increased business opportunities, we are looking for an IAS Assistant Vice President to provide technical and operational support within the Integrated Absence Solutions Practice. The ideal candidate is an experienced leader in absence and disability management, with at least 7 years in the field. They excel at managing client consulting engagements, developing strategic plans, and leading benefit analysis and process improvements. Strong knowledge of federal and state disability and leave regulations (FMLA, ADA, PPL/PFML) is essential, along with experience in vendor and client management.
• Deploy, deliver and manage client consulting engagements
• Create strategic multi-year consulting plans to deploy necessary IAS services to all assigned clients including but not limited to marketing, implementation support, audit, current state assessment/operational review, benchmarking, policy review, alternative plan design analysis, etc.
• Conduct strategic client meetings for both current and future state benefit analysis, technology harmonization, and integration of workforce planning for internal and external stakeholders
• Participate in financial analysis of cost/insurance solutions related to employer life, disability and leave programs
• Evaluate leave administration functions and connections, enabling clients’ employee absence programs and recommend process improvements
• Analyze employer Plan documents, SPDs, policies and procedures for compliance, design, and operational improvement opportunities
• Conduct benchmarking of existing Life, Disability and Leave designs against comparator groups for new program introduction
• Manage vendor implementation plans with clients to ensure successful transition and communications
• Prepare client presentations and reports for internal and external partners
• Work with Client Service Team to assist with client/carrier relationship development and issue resolution including but not limited to complex claims resolution
• Manage individual client service budgets
• Mentor junior colleagues
• Attend lunch and evening events with clients to build ongoing relationships
• Regular business travel throughout the United States
Qualifications
• Bachelor’s degree
• 7+ years of progressive experience in absence management, disability management, or benefits administration.
• Deep knowledge of federal, state, and local regulations related to absence management (e.g., FMLA, State Disability and Leaves, PPL/PFML, ADA).
• Experience managing vendor relationships and overseeing outsourced service providers.
• Understanding of HR systems and tools, with a focus on absence management technologies.
• Understanding of large, national clients’ needs and challenges
• Proven ability to develop and execute strategic plans that align with business objectives.
• Excellent communication, interpersonal, and presentation skills, with the ability to build relationships at all organizational levels.
• Understanding of Life and Disability group underwriting and funding arrangements
• Strong analytical and problem-solving skills, with the ability to use data to drive decisions and improvements.
• Ability to lead and motivate teams in a fast-paced, dynamic environment.
• Strong customer service skills with the ability to develop strong relationships with multiple stakeholders and a proven track record of delivering exceptional client service
• Excellent communication, analytical, critical thinking and problem-solving skills with proven ability to interact with associates, clients and vendors at all levels of responsibility
• Demonstrated proficiency with Microsoft Office products (Excel, PowerPoint, Word, Outlook) with advanced ability to manipulate large spreadsheets, census data, benchmarking data, etc.
• Legal right to work in the United States.

About Lockton
Lockton is the largest privately held independent insurance brokerage in the world. Since 1966, our independence has allowed us to serve our clients, take care of our people and give back to our communities. As such, our 13,100+ Associates doing business in over 155 countries are empowered to do what’s right every day.
